Liza Minnelli stars in this enlightening song and dance gala about growing old but staying young inside. Mavis (Minnelli) signs up to teach tap dancing at a church, but when she’s bombarded with a clu...( read more  read more... )msy group of problem-ridden enrollees, she realizes she’s in for more than she bargained for. As Mavis and her students rehearse for the big year-end recital, they confess to their frustrations of womanhood, bond together and are transformed into a formidable dance troupe.
